ZBlog安装时数据库连接失败可能因多种原因导致,请确认ZBlog配置文件中的数据库设置是否正确,包括数据库类型、用户名、密码和主机地址,如果使用本地数据库,请确保数据库服务正在运行且ZBlog能访问,若使用远程数据库,请检查网络连接和防火墙设置,若问题仍存在,请查看ZBlog日志以获取详细错误信息,或尝试重新安装ZBlog。
在部署ZBlog博客系统时,很多用户在安装过程中都会遇到数据库连接失败的问题,数据库连接失败可能由多种原因引起,包括配置错误、数据库服务器未启动、网络问题等,本文将详细介绍如何解决ZBlog安装时数据库连接失败的问题。
检查数据库配置
数据库连接失败的首要原因是配置文件中的数据库设置不正确,请确保config.php文件中的数据库连接信息准确无误,以下是一个典型的数据库配置示例:
define('DB_HOST', 'localhost');
define('DB_USER', 'your_db_username');
define('DB_PASS', 'your_db_password');
define('DB_NAME', 'your_db_name');
-
确认数据库主机地址:确保数据库服务器正在运行,并且主机地址正确,如果是本地数据库,可以使用
localhost或0.0.1。 -
验证数据库用户名和密码:确保输入的用户名和密码正确,并且该用户具有访问数据库的权限。
-
检查数据库名称:确保数据库名称正确,并且数据库服务器上存在该数据库。
确保数据库服务器正常运行
如果数据库配置正确,但仍然无法连接,可能是数据库服务器未启动或存在问题,请按照以下步骤进行检查:
-
检查MySQL服务状态:在Windows系统中,可以在服务管理器中查看MySQL服务的状态,在Linux系统中,可以使用
systemctl status mysql或service mysql status命令来检查MySQL服务的状态。 -
启动数据库服务:如果服务未启动,可以使用相应的命令启动数据库服务,在Windows系统中,可以右键点击服务管理器中的MySQL服务并选择“启动”;在Linux系统中,可以使用
systemctl start mysql或service mysql start命令启动MySQL服务。 -
检查防火墙设置:确保防火墙允许ZBlog应用程序与数据库服务器之间的通信,如果防火墙阻止了通信,请将相应的端口添加到防火墙的允许列表中。
检查网络连接
数据库连接失败有时也可能是由于网络问题引起的,请确保ZBlog应用程序所在的服务器能够访问数据库服务器,并且网络连接正常,可以通过以下步骤进行检查:
-
使用ping命令测试网络连通性:在命令行中使用
ping命令测试ZBlog应用程序所在服务器与数据库服务器之间的网络连通性。ping your_db_server_ip
如果无法ping通数据库服务器IP,请检查网络连接或联系网络管理员。
-
检查MySQL端口是否开放:确保MySQL服务器上的默认端口(通常是3306)已开放,并且没有被防火墙阻止。
查看错误日志
如果以上步骤都无法解决问题,建议查看ZBlog的错误日志以获取更多详细的错误信息,错误日志通常位于ZBlog安装目录下的logs文件夹中,通过查看错误日志,可以更准确地定位问题所在。
解决ZBlog安装时数据库连接失败的问题需要仔细检查数据库配置、确保数据库服务器正常运行、检查网络连接以及查看错误日志,希望本文能帮助您顺利解决这个问题,使您的ZBlog博客系统能够正常运行。


还没有评论,来说两句吧...